Mom Can’t Cope With Reason Toddler Keeps Getting New Brother’s Name Wrong
Summary
A mother in New York shared how her 2-year-old daughter calls her new baby brother "Math-me" instead of his actual name, Matthew. The toddler mishears how the name is said and prefers her own version, which the family finds cute and has allowed to continue.Key Facts
- Serrena Pedersen had a baby boy named Matthew on March 27, 2026.
- Her 2-year-old daughter, Carter, calls him “Math-me” instead of Matthew.
- Carter mishears her parents saying Matthew and tries to repeat what she hears.
- Pedersen and her husband find the name mix-up adorable and have not corrected her.
- A video explaining this situation was posted on TikTok and has over 1.3 million views.
- The video received more than 210,000 likes and nearly 4,000 comments.
- Many parents shared similar stories of toddlers misunderstanding words.
- The family believes this will be a fun story for the children as they grow up.
